在当今这个数据驱动的时代,金融行业的大数据建模技术已经成为了风险管理升级的关键。大数据建模不仅能够帮助金融机构更好地理解市场动态,还能够提高决策效率,降低风险。下面,我们就来揭开金融行业大数据建模的神秘面纱。
大数据建模在金融行业的应用
1. 风险评估
在金融行业中,风险评估是最基本的需求之一。通过大数据建模,金融机构可以分析历史数据,预测未来的风险。例如,通过分析客户的信用记录、交易行为等数据,可以评估客户的信用风险。
代码示例(Python):
import pandas as pd
from sklearn.linear_model import LogisticRegression
# 加载数据
data = pd.read_csv('credit_data.csv')
# 特征和标签
X = data.drop('default', axis=1)
y = data['default']
# 创建模型
model = LogisticRegression()
# 训练模型
model.fit(X, y)
# 预测
predictions = model.predict(X)
# 评估模型
accuracy = model.score(X, y)
print(f'模型准确率:{accuracy}')
2. 信用评分
信用评分是金融机构对客户信用状况的一种量化评估。大数据建模可以帮助金融机构更准确地评估客户的信用风险,从而制定合理的信贷政策。
代码示例(Python):
import pandas as pd
from sklearn.ensemble import RandomForestClassifier
# 加载数据
data = pd.read_csv('credit_data.csv')
# 特征和标签
X = data.drop('credit_score', axis=1)
y = data['credit_score']
# 创建模型
model = RandomForestClassifier()
# 训练模型
model.fit(X, y)
# 预测
predictions = model.predict(X)
# 评估模型
accuracy = model.score(X, y)
print(f'模型准确率:{accuracy}')
3. 个性化营销
大数据建模可以帮助金融机构了解客户需求,从而实现个性化营销。通过分析客户的消费行为、兴趣爱好等数据,金融机构可以为客户提供更加精准的金融产品和服务。
代码示例(Python):
import pandas as pd
from sklearn.cluster import KMeans
# 加载数据
data = pd.read_csv('customer_data.csv')
# 特征
X = data[['age', 'income', 'spending']]
# 创建模型
model = KMeans(n_clusters=3)
# 训练模型
model.fit(X)
# 获取聚类标签
labels = model.labels_
# 打印聚类结果
print(f'聚类结果:{labels}')
大数据建模的挑战
尽管大数据建模在金融行业具有广泛的应用前景,但同时也面临着一些挑战:
1. 数据质量
数据质量是大数据建模的基础。在金融行业中,数据来源多样,数据质量参差不齐,这给建模工作带来了很大挑战。
2. 隐私保护
金融行业涉及大量敏感信息,如何保护客户隐私是大数据建模过程中必须考虑的问题。
3. 技术难题
大数据建模需要运用到多种算法和工具,对于技术团队来说,这是一个不小的挑战。
总结
大数据建模在金融行业的应用前景广阔,可以帮助金融机构提高风险管理水平,实现个性化营销。然而,在实际应用过程中,仍需克服数据质量、隐私保护和技术难题等挑战。相信随着技术的不断发展,大数据建模将在金融行业发挥越来越重要的作用。
